Newport Beach, California - December 3, 2002 - LiveTime Software today announced the release of LiveTime Support 1.0, the first in a new suite of applications to address the burgeoning demand for Business Activity Monitoring (BAM) solutions.
LiveTime Support is an affordable Web-based technical support product delivering innovative customer support and helpdesk facilities so that small to medium enterprise (SME) technology companies can increase the effectiveness of their technical support operation, reduce costs and improve responsiveness to customer enquiries. LiveTime Support provides a comprehensive range of features out-of-the-box, with no hidden costs for essential functionality such as reporting, service level management, knowledge management and asset management. Considered by key analysts as the next generation of business metrics functionality, BAM is a business strategy that gives executives "instant insight" into the operating parameters of their enterprise. BAM technology collates and analyzes business information from across the enterprise and provides reports to decision makers in real time enabling them to respond rapidly to changing business conditions, such as changing sales patterns. Milind Govekar and Roy Schulte from Gartner Dataquest illustrate the significant impact BAM technology can have on an enterprise: "Speed and agility are the marks of a progressive enterprise that sees and understands clearly and quickly how its business is performing, so it can react with appropriate decisions and strategies. Although most enterprises are awash with information stored on databases and in the minds of its employees and managers, aggressive enterprises will be using business activity monitoring (BAM) to integrate and make intelligent real-time use of this information." Technical Specifications: LiveTime Support's highly scalable architecture supports thousands of users and customers. Designed to run on multiple platforms, it can be deployed on a wide variety of hardware and software to maximise your existing infrastructure. Application servers supported include IBM Websphere, BEA Weblogic 7, Apache Tomcat 3.0 and WebObjects 5.2. Deployment platforms include Windows 2000 Server SP2, Solaris 8, Mac OS X Server v10.1.1 or later. Uses any JDBC 2.0 compliant database for data storage. LiveTime Support is completely server driven, requires no plugins and uses a thin web client interface for all operations. System Requirements: 256MB of physical RAM and 500MB of available hard disk space. |
